The objective of the article consists in a development and a research of the offered by the author orthogonal coding as a way of noise immunity’s increase using the example of the information communication systems with phase-shift keying. The orthogonal coding is an analogue of convolutional coding over the rational numbers’ field. Properties of orthogonality of proposed codes allow to strengthen significance of useful signal with simultaneous weakening of influence of noise. The orthogonal coding allows to provide the required quality of communication with a smaller energy cost. The main attention is paid to an actual problem of synchronization of signals in combination with orthogonal codes.
